What Should You Know About Teeth Whitening?

Teeth whitening is a cosmetic procedure that employs peroxide-based whitening formulas to break down stain compounds lodged inside the tooth structure of your teeth. The whitening agent reaches the porous enamel and oxidizes the pigment bonds that create dark spots.

Patients can choose from two common forms of professional teeth whitening: same-day treatment and custom at-home systems. In-office teeth whitening usually uses a more powerful whitening solution paired with light energy to amplify the chemical reaction. At-home systems apply custom-fitted appliances made from impressions of your natural dentition to ensure even coverage of the whitening gel.

Each approach are safe when administered or guided by a qualified dental professional. Before we proceed with teeth whitening procedure, our dental professionals will evaluate the health of your smile to establish that you're a good get more info candidate and will deliver the most effective results.

The Teeth Whitening Treatment: Your Visit Breakdown

  1. Pre-Treatment Evaluation and Oral Health Review — Before we apply any whitening agents, our dental team complete a complete evaluation of your teeth and gum tissue to identify and address any oral health concerns that must be resolved before beginning. This step also gives us insight into your desired results and identify the most suitable method for you.
  2. Professional Cleaning and Plaque Removal — To achieve the best whitening results, your smile should be professionally cleaned preceding the application of whitening treatment. Removing tartar buildup ensures the whitening solution can penetrate without barriers.
  3. Gum Isolation — A protective resin coating is put in place over the gumline and surrounding structures to protect the gum area from irritating sensitive soft tissue. This is a critical precaution that differentiates professional treatment from at-home products.
  4. Whitening Solution Administration — A high-concentration whitening gel is applied methodically across all visible tooth surfaces. With same-day whitening, a UV or LED lamp is sometimes positioned above the smile to accelerate the gel's effectiveness.
  5. Whitening Cycle — According to your desired outcome, the solution could involve two to four short sessions in one sitting. Every round typically takes around fifteen minutes, allowing the peroxide to penetrate deeply between rounds.
  6. Shade Evaluation and Progress Check — Once the treatment is complete, our clinicians evaluate your current enamel color compared to your starting shade using clinical measurement tools. This process shows you've reached your desired results and evaluate if additional sessions are needed.
  7. Whitening Maintenance and Results Preservation — Before you leave, our cosmetic dentistry staff provides take-home guidance including foods and drinks to avoid, ways to minimize discomfort, and a timeline for maintenance treatments to ensure your whitening staying vibrant.

Who Qualifies as a Suitable Candidate for Teeth Whitening?

Teeth whitening is most effective for people who experience yellowing, discoloration, or staining caused by dietary habits and lifestyle factors. Ideal patients maintain clinically sound dentition and soft tissue free of significant decay or active periodontal disease — because addressing active oral health problems first ensures more stable results.

Those with intrinsic staining should understand that chairside whitening produce less dramatic improvement. For these patients, we could propose complementary procedures like bonded veneers or tooth contouring as a more complete remedy.

Expectant or nursing mothers should plan to postpone whitening until this stage of life before undergoing whitening treatment. In the same way, younger patients under sixteen below the threshold of sixteen are typically advised to wait until tooth development is fully developed before starting whitening services.

Frequently Asked Teeth Whitening FAQ

How much time does a in-office teeth whitening treatment require?

A chairside teeth whitening session generally lasts sixty to ninety minutes, according to how many application rounds are needed. Professionally supervised home whitening programs often mean wearing custom trays for a prescribed period determined by our team.

Is teeth whitening associated with pain?

A large portion of those treated experience little or no soreness during chairside teeth whitening. Certain patients could experience brief zingy feelings during or immediately after treatment, particularly when pre-existing sensitivity exists. Our dental professionals can recommend anti-sensitivity products and tailor the approach to limit side effects.

How long do the results of remain visible?

The outcomes of whitening treatment tend to persist well over a year, shaped by what you eat and drink. Regularly drinking chromogenic foods and beverages tends to diminish the duration of your whitening. Routine touch-up teeth whitening visits roughly every twelve to eighteen months help maintain results looking fresh.

Will teeth whitening change the color of porcelain or composite restorations?

Teeth whitening only affects natural tooth enamel — peroxide does not alter man-made dental materials. It's for this reason that it's important to discuss any existing dental appliances with your provider, so ClearWave can map out replacement of older restorations subsequent to whitening where relevant.
